Hướng dẫn học lập trình php hiệu quả

Thảo luận trong 'Tư vấn - Du học - Tuyển sinh' bắt đầu bởi t11nguyen, 19 Tháng mười hai 2017.

  1. t11nguyen

    t11nguyen Member Thành viên

    Bài viết:
    141
    Đã được thích:
    0
    Diendanraovataz.net - Diễn đàn rao vặt - Đăng tin mua bán - Quảng cáo miễn phí - Hiệu quả - Giới thiệu tổng quan về tiếng nói hoc lap trinh web, những đặc điểm tính năng, phương tiện thiết yếu...

    Giới thiệu:
    PHP vay mượn một số cú pháp từ C, Pert, Shell và Java. Nó là một tiếng nói lai, lấy những tính năng tốt nhất từ tiếng nói khác và tạo ra một tiếng nói kịch bản (script language): dễ tiêu dùng và mạnh mẽ. Mã nguồn (code) php được tiêu dùng với rộng rãi mục đích trong đó: đặc trưng thích hợp cho vững mạnh web và với thể được nhúng vào những mã HTML.


    Chèn mã php vào mã HTML:
    Mã php khởi đầu bằng thẻ mở: , giữa những câu lệnh phải với dấu ; . những đoạn mã php chỉ với tác dụng lúc đặt trong cặp thẻ này. Máy chủ web sẽ bỏ qua ko dịch (thực thi) những đoạn mã HTML, lúc gặp những đoạn mã php nó sẽ thực thi-hay còn gọi là chạy, kết quả sẽ ở dạng text như:text plain (văn bản trơn), mã html, css, javascript, json, xml... một trang HTML với thể với rộng rãi đoạn mã PHP.

    Ví dụ:










    Nhúng mã php vào html


    <>
    echo "xin chào!";
    ?>


    <>
    //chỉ xuất ra một chuỗi dạng text ( văn bản thuần tuý )
    echo "Đoạn mã php lồng trong thẻ h2";
    ?>



    <>
    //chỉ xuất ra một chuỗi dạng text ( văn bản thuần tuý )
    echo "Đoạn mã php lồng trong thẻ h3";
    ?>




    những đặc điểm của php
    PHP là một tiếng nói lập trình web rất được ưa thích, hiện là tiếng nói lập trình web rộng rãi nhất. Nhờ vào một số đặc điểm sau:


    PHP dễ học và linh hoạt
    toàn bộ hàm tương trợ và rộng rãi phần mở rộng phong phú
    đặc trưng mã nguồn mở, thường xuyên nâng cấp, chạy được trên rộng rãi máy chủ web, rộng rãi hệ quản lý (đa nền tảng)
    cùng đồng tiêu dùng và tương trợ toàn bộ
    Ngoài phần code chính (thường gọi là code thuần), những phần mở rộng cũng rất phong phú nhưng mà miễn phí như rộng rãi frame work, rộng rãi CMS
    những mã nguồn san sớt trên mạng tìm được toàn bộ và tiện lợi
    Được tích hợp và tiêu dùng ổn định trong một mô phỏng LAMP = Linux+Apache+Mysql+Php, mã nguồn mở, tầm giá tốt.
    những hosting tương trợ rộng rãi
    ....
    những chức năng của php
    trước tiên và cũng là quan yếu nhất, nó phụ trách vai trò của: tiếng nói kịch bản phía máy chủ (Server Side script) - máy chủ sẽ tiếp thụ request (yêu cầu) từ máy khách (client) - máy chủ web sẽ triệu gọi file mã nguồn tương ứng. Trong file mã nguồn này đựng những mã php để xử lý request - trình thông ngôn sẽ dịch mã php sang mã HTML, CSS, XML,...trả ra cho máy chủ web, máy chủ web trả lại thông tin (reponse) cho máy khách. Dữ liệu nhận được từ máy khách là những đoạn mã dạng text như HTML, CSS,...mà không thể thấy mã php ( vì đã được thực thi thành dạng text ) - đảm bảo được tính bảo mật, đây cũng là chức năng cơ bản và quan yếu của một tiếng nói phía máy chủ.

    tuy nhiên PHP còn với thể:

    Xử lý ảnh
    Cho phép và xử lý file upload ( vận tải file lên server )
    Thiếp lập và xử lý cookie, session
    (*) Thao tác tới hạ tầng dữ liệu
    Gửi email
    (*) Xử lý dữ liệu nhận được từ form nhập liệu
    ....
    ưng chuẩn php, một trang web tĩnh (static webpage), thường chỉ phần giao diện tại máy khách - tương tác tới máy chủ web , trở thành một trang web động ( nội dung thay đổi, tùy biến theo những sự kiện, yêu cầu) - hay được gọi là dynamic webpage. Học lập trình php vì vậy cũng hay được gọi là: lập trình web động với php, lập trình vận dụng web, ...

    những phương tiện thiết yếu
    Để học tập và lập trình php Các bạn cần có:

    Phần mềm tạo môi trường hay còn gọi là máy chủ offline (server offline)
    Trình soạn thảo mã nguồn hay còn gọi editor
    Việc học lập trình php, thường thì máy tính bạn làm cho việc đóng vai trò làm cho máy khách và cũng làm cho máy chủ. Bạn cần một phần mềm đê tạo máy chủ web. Máy chủ web (phầm mềm máy chủ web) là một service trong hệ quản lý, hay được tiêu dùng là Apache, tuy nhiên còn với Ngix, Litespeed,... với những phần mềm tích hợp thành một bộ từ máy chủ web cho tới máy chủ hạ tầng dữ liệu,... và những tiện thể ích khác - rất tiện lợi cho việc học tập, vững mạnh vận dụng web tại máy tư nhân. những phầm mềm này còn được gọi là "máy chủ offline (server offline)".

    Dưới đây là một số phần mềm tạo môi trường để với thể thực thi mã php:

    Wamp,
    Xampp,
    vertrigoserv
    AppServ
    Trong ngừng thi côngĐây, tác nhái giới thiệu phần mềm Xampp. Mỗi lúc làm cho việc (lập trình, học tập) trước tiên Các bạn phải bật phần mềm này và bật service Apache.

    Kế tới, bạn cần một trình soạn thảo. Việc soạn những mã lệnh - hay còn gọi là code, với php còn được gọi là script; với thể ưng chuẩn bất kỳ trình soạn thảo văn bản nào, thuần tuý như notepad. tuy nhiên, do tính thô sơ của notepad bạn phải: nhớ câu lệnh, tên hàm,..., một số lỗi với thể thấy trước như quên dấu nháy, quên dấu ; vv... đều ko cảnh báo - bạn phải dò thủ công... những trình soạn thảo - editor, tương trợ rộng rãi tính năng, tạo điều kiện cho người lập trình tốn ít công sức, trong ngừng thi côngĐây phải nói tới tính năng autocomeplete - lúc bạn gõ sắp đúng tên hàm, trình soạn thảo sẽ hiển thị một gợi ý về tên hàm - tất nhiên những thông số...vv


    một số trình soạn thảo code php (php editor)
    Netbean - miễn phí - rộng rãi plugin
    Sublime - (có phí) - tương đối nhẹ
    (*)Codelobster - miễn phí - với thể code được mã HTML, CSS, JAVASCRIPT
    phpstorm
    Notepad++ - thiết yếu ( nhẹ, tiện thể dụng)
    Dreamweaver - rộng rãi tính năng mạnh mẽ nhưng với phí



    Tác nhái giới thiệu trình soạn thảo Codelobster, nó miễn phí - toàn bộ tính năng thiết yếu, với nói code luôn phần mã HTML, CSS, JAVASCRIPT...nhiều tính năng phụ trợ khác. Bạn với thể tiêu dùng phối hợp notepad++ và codelobster.

    tìm kiếm tham khảo thông tin ở đâu?
    Trang web chính thức của php là php.net, Các bạn nên tham khảo trang này để xem những thông tin như: những hàm, sự thay đổi những phiên bản,... đặc trưng Các bạn nên lưu tâm tới phiên bản php được tiêu dùng, một số tính năng - hàm ở phiên bản cũ được tiêu dùng thì ở phiên bản mới bị bỏ đi, hoặc thay đổi, một số tính năng mới. ngày nay Các bạn nên học php phiên bản 5.4 trở lên ( php 5.4 ).

    TỔNG KẾT
    Qua bài này, Các bạn cần nắm được tổng quan về tiếng nói lập trình php cũng như chuẩn bị được những phương tiện thiết yếu.
    Bài kế tiếp - Các bạn sẽ Tìm hiểu về cú pháp cơ bản, kiểu dữ liệu trong php. Đây là một trong những bài học nền tảng Các bạn cần nắm vững lúc học tiếng nói lập trình.
    Chúc Các bạn học tập tốt.
     
    Cùng đọc NỘI QUY DIỄN ĐÀN và ý thức thực hiện cùng BQT xây dựng cộng đồng thêm vững mạnh bạn nhé
    ***** Xin đừng Spam vì một diễn đàn trong sạch *****
Địa chỉ thu mua do cu ho chi minh uy tín, Official Premium Account Reseller Premiumkeystore.com Easily, Instant delivery & Trusted.
Tags:

Chia sẻ trang này